I’ve read Tynion before. Something is Killing the Children, The Woods. All YA, twee, underwhelming. So I didn’t expect much going in and was very pleasantly surprised by this awesome and very much adult comic series about…well, the truth.
Such a tragically malleable thing these days, isn’t it? Well, Tynion picked up on that and came up with an absolutely wild spin on the reasons for it, creating a world of rival agencies that fight to control the very fabric of our reality and one man caught in the middle of it all. Great from the get-go, this story just gets darker and stranger the further you go. Conspiracy theories, madness, oh so tangled webs. Who knew Tynion had it in him? The writing’s so good. Such a dramatic improvement over his teeny-bopper series. The art’s terrific too, watercolors and ink? Moody, stark, beautiful. Compliments the story perfectly. All in all, very, very good, Can’t wait to read more. Recommended.
